Output 3d32c711cdc8525494f835257698fa40ce65af4a7fcb9699b210222a4bd9c229:0

value
2414
script pubkey
OP_0 OP_PUSHBYTES_20 5df89b50a8ad944f6e047bcf77a54ad02bd9a600
address
bc1qthufk59g4k2y7msy008h0f226q4anfsqqwu3my
transaction
3d32c711cdc8525494f835257698fa40ce65af4a7fcb9699b210222a4bd9c229
spent
true